Begin is the award-winning early learning company offering children the best start possible through digital, physical, and experiential learning programs. With play-based products including HOMER, codeSpark, and Little Passports, plus innovative learning memberships, Begin builds the skills that matter most to help kids achieve their fullest potential in school and life. Begin is backed by the most recognized names in early childhood development, including LEGO Ventures, Sesame Workshop, and Gymboree Play & Music.
